>! I ended up reaching almost $19mil total earnings by the time I built all 4 obelisks and the golden clock. Also the scepter is a super useful time saver. !< By the time I reached 100%, I had 3 full wine sheds and 85% of island farm covered in star fruit and deluxe speed-gro. Every monday, I’d harvest 300+ star fruit and 116 ancient fruit, collect 260 bottles of wine, restart the wines, sell all the wine and excess star fruit. It would take from 6am to 6pm even with the >! obelisks and scepter !<. At that point I was making about $1M a week. Each shed gets you about $300k/week. >! I had 2 deluxe wine sheds for most of the 1st $10M though. I think 2 sheds might be sufficient if you are willing to keep doing it week after week. !<

Is everything grown for aesthetics and preference or is there a reason to amass certain crops?


SevenDragonWaffles

OP could be growing at least four of these crops as loved gifts. But I think they just like the look. >!Cactus: Sam and Linus; Strawberry: Demetrius and Maru; Chili: Lewis and Shane; Grape: Vincent.!<
